How many hours do sheet metal workers work?

Sheet metal workers typically work full-time hours, often around 40 hours per week, with some overtime during busy periods or project deadlines. Work schedules can include early mornings, evenings, or weekends depending on project needs and safety regulations. Overtime may be required for large or urgent projects, especially in construction or manufacturing environments.

What is the difference between Hawk Custom Sheet Metal vs Sheet Metal Worker?

AspectHawk Custom Sheet MetalSheet Metal Worker
CertificationsOften requires specialized training or certifications in custom fabricationTypically requires apprenticeship and journeyman certification
Work EnvironmentDesigning and fabricating custom metal components, often in a shop settingInstalling, maintaining, and repairing metal ductwork and systems on-site
Industry UsageUsed in custom projects, architectural metalwork, and specialized fabricationCommonly employed in construction, HVAC, and maintenance sectors

Hawk Custom Sheet Metal focuses on custom fabrication and design, often requiring specialized skills, while Sheet Metal Workers primarily install and repair metal systems on-site. Both roles are essential in the metalworking industry but differ in scope and daily tasks.
